Casos de prueba de pasarela de pago: tutorial con escenarios de prueba

Pruebas de pasarela de pago

Pruebas de pasarela de pago es una prueba de la pasarela de pago en un sistema para compras y transacciones en línea por parte de los usuarios. El objetivo de la prueba de la pasarela de pago es garantizar la seguridad, la fiabilidad y el rendimiento de la pasarela de pago mediante el cifrado y la protección de los datos de pago entre el usuario y el comerciante, al tiempo que se proporciona una experiencia de pago fluida.

Un sistema de pasarela de pago es un servicio de aplicaciones de comercio electrónico que aprueba el pago con tarjeta de crédito para compras en línea. Las pasarelas de pago protegen los datos de la tarjeta de crédito mediante el cifrado de información confidencial, como números de tarjeta de crédito, datos del titular de la cuenta, etc. Esta información se transmite de forma segura entre el cliente y el comerciante y viceversa. Las pasarelas de pago modernas también aprueban de forma segura los pagos mediante tarjetas de débito, transferencias bancarias electrónicas, tarjetas de efectivo, puntos de recompensa, etc.

Únase a nuestro proyecto de prueba de pasarela de pago en vivo de forma gratuita

Tipos de sistema de pasarela de pago

Sistema de Pasarela de Pago
El conocimiento de la pasarela de pago es importante

Pasarela de pago alojada

El sistema de pasarela de pago alojado dirige al cliente fuera de un sitio de comercio electrónico al enlace de la pasarela durante el proceso de pago. Una vez realizado el pago, el cliente regresará a un sitio de comercio electrónico. Para este tipo de pago no necesita una identificación de comerciante; un ejemplo de pasarela de pago alojada son PayPal, Noche y WorldPay.

Pasarela de pago compartida

En una pasarela de pago compartida, mientras se procesa el pago, el cliente es dirigido a la página de pago y permanece en el sitio de comercio electrónico. Una vez que se completan los detalles del pago, continúa el proceso de pago. Dado que no abandona el sitio de comercio electrónico mientras se procesa el pago, este modo es fácil y más preferible; un ejemplo de pasarela de pago compartida es eWay, Stripe.

Tipos de prueba para el dominio de pago

Las pruebas de pasarela de pago deben incluir

Prueba de funcion: Es el acto de probar la funcionalidad base de la pasarela de pago. Es para verificar si la aplicación se comporta de la misma manera que se supone que debe ser como manejo de pedidos, cálculo, adición de IVA según el país, etc.

Integración: : Pruebe la integración con su servicio de tarjeta de crédito.

Desempeno: identifique varias métricas de rendimiento, como la mayor cantidad posible de usuarios que ingresan a través de puertas de enlace durante un día específico y conviértalos en usuarios simultáneos.

Seguridad: Debe realizar un pase de seguridad profundo para la Pasarela de Pago.

Cómo probar la pasarela de pago: lista de verificación completa

Antes de comenzar a probar –

  • Recopile datos de prueba adecuados para el número de tarjeta de crédito ficticio para maestro, visa, maestro, etc.
  • Recopile información de la pasarela de pago como Google Wallet, Paypal u otros
  • Recoger documento de pasarela de pago con códigos de error
  • Comprender la sesión y los parámetros pasados ​​a través de la aplicación y la pasarela de pago.
  • Comprender y probar la cantidad de información relacionada que se pasa a través de una cadena de consulta, una variable o una sesión.
  • Junto con el idioma de la pasarela de pago, consulte el idioma de la aplicación.
  • Según las diversas configuraciones de la pasarela de pago, como el formato de moneda, se recopilan los datos del suscriptor.

Ejemplo de casos de prueba de pasarela de pago

A continuación se presentan casos/escenarios de prueba importantes para verificar la pasarela de pago.

Sr # Casos de prueba
1 Durante el proceso de pago intenta cambiar el idioma de la pasarela de pago
2 Después del pago exitoso, pruebe todos los componentes necesarios, ya sea que se recuperen o no
3 Compruebe qué sucede si la pasarela de pago deja de responder durante el pago
4 Durante el proceso de pago comprueba qué pasa si finaliza la sesión
5 Durante el proceso de pago verifique lo que sucede en el backend
6 Compruebe qué sucede si el proceso de pago falla
7 Verifique las entradas de la base de datos para ver si almacenan detalles de tarjetas de crédito o no
8 Durante el proceso de pago consulte las páginas de error y las páginas de seguridad
9 Verifique la configuración del bloqueador de ventanas emergentes y vea qué sucede si un bloqueador de ventanas emergentes está activado y desactivado
10 Entre la pasarela de pago y las páginas de verificación de la aplicación
11 Verifique el pago exitoso, se envía un código de éxito a la aplicación y se muestra una página de confirmación al usuario
12 Verifique si la transacción se procesa de inmediato o si el procesamiento se realiza en mano de su banco.
13 Después de una transacción exitosa, verifique si la pasarela de pago regresa a su aplicación
14 Verifique todos los formatos y mensajes cuando el proceso de pago sea exitoso
15 A menos que no tenga un recibo de autorización de la pasarela de pago, el producto no debe enviarse
16 Informar al titular de cualquier transacción procesada a través del correo electrónico. Encriptar el contenido del correo
17 Verifique el formato de monto con formato de moneda
18 Comprueba si cada una de las opciones de pago es seleccionable
19 Compruebe si cada opción de pago enumerada abre la opción de pago respectiva según las especificaciones
20 Verifique si la pasarela de pago tiene por defecto la opción de tarjeta de débito/crédito deseada
21 Verificar que la opción predeterminada para tarjeta de débito muestra el menú desplegable de selección de tarjeta

Cosas a considerar antes de comprar el paquete Gateway

  • Si has comprado un paquete de carrito de compras, infórmate sobre su compatibilidad
  • Si vence el paquete de la pasarela de compras, solicite al proveedor de la pasarela de pagos una lista de las aplicaciones compatibles.
  • La puerta de enlace debe ofrecer protección del sistema de verificación de direcciones.
  • Descubra los tipos de protección de transacciones que se ofrecen
  • Consulta qué tipos de tarjetas de débito o crédito acepta la pasarela de pago elegida
  • Verifique las tarifas de transacción que cobra una pasarela de pago
  • Compruebe si las pasarelas cobran el pago directamente en el formulario o lo dirigen a otra página para completar la compra.